So, after a frantic loading session yesterday, our club fun shoot today was a hoot.

I shot at steel knockdown targets with my GSG1911 with mixed results, but 4/10 was a good result I thought (damm small things)

Mrs Hrun shot well in the club comp and hopes to place well with results to follow.

And now for the full bore have a go (I.e. me burning a load of money (ammo) so that people can shoot something they cannot shoot at our smallbore range.

After loading an extra 50 rounds, an issue with the range owner restricting supersonic rounds to guns with mods only (he has a neighbour who moved out of the city and bought a house by a gun range, complaining about noise.. duh) we shot a total of two rounds..

.308 zeroed for 200 yards, by eye on a 25 yard range and shot at 50 yards. The first time Mrs Hrun has pulled the trigger on a .308.. happy days

So, we spent the remaining time letting members shoot a .44 flintlock and .69 carbine musket (which IMHO was just a noisy as a .308)

Everyone had a blast, and all shots left a smile on various faces. The first pic is a 50 yard shot with a musket with rudimentary sights.. happy day was had :-)
